Dog Haiku

I love my master;
      Thus I perfume myself with
           This long rotten squirrel.

Today I sniffed
      Many dog butts - I celebrate
           By kissing your face.

Sleeping here, my chin on
      Your foot - no greater bliss, well,
           Maybe catching rats.

You may call them fleas
      But they are far more - I call
           Them a vocation.

I am your best friend;
      Now, always, and especially
           When you are eating.

The cat is not all
      Bad - she fills the litter box
           With Tootsie Rolls.

I lie belly-up
      In the sunshine, happier than
           You ever will be.

I lift my leg and
      Whiz on each bush. Hello, Spot
           Sniff this and weep.

My human is home!
      I am so ecstatic I have
           Made a puddle.

Dig under fence - why?
      Because it's there. Because it's
           There. Because it's there.

Look in my eyes and
      Deny it. No human could love
           You as much as I do.

My owners' mood is
      Romantic - I lie near their
           Feet. I fart a big one.
